About

Sweet Pea has a soft, delicate floral scent with fresh, subtly sweet undertones and a hint of green. Its aroma is often described as light, airy, and slightly powdery, evoking a gentle springtime freshness. This note adds a tender, uplifting quality to floral bouquets in fragrances.

Origin

In perfumery, sweet pea is typically recreated using accords of other floral and green materials, as the natural flower yields little to no extractable oil. Synthetic molecules and blends of muguet, rose, and violet notes are often used to mimic its scent. The plant, Lathyrus odoratus, is native to the Mediterranean region.

Usage in Perfumery

Perfumers use sweet pea primarily as a heart note to impart freshness and a soft floral character to bouquets. It blends well with other delicate florals such as peony, freesia, and lily of the valley, as well as with light musks and green notes. Its role is to add a tender, uplifting nuance to feminine and spring-inspired compositions.
